I wanted to share with you an experience I had with a great company - Silver State Specialties. I had an issue with my courtyard fireplace not working, it simply would not start or make any click of ignition or anything. The previous home owners had it wired up and I was at a loss on why it would not start, I figured it was electrical.

Lee (from Silver State Specialties) came out and checked it. He told me it was going to be a week to get the parts and he'd call back when it was ready. A week later he arrived with the parts, he started to work on it and then told me it was just a battery. For some reason the builder had it wired to look like electrical which through him off. Anyways good news was no parts were needed.

He didn't charge me anything.

So I did a Yelp review and now this post, I hope other contractors can learn from this kind of ethic. He does Insulation, Mirrors, Garage Doors and showers in the North West Area of Vegas.
